Do not wait; the time will never be 'just right.' Start where you stand, And work with whatever tools you may have at your command, And better tools will be found as you go along.
â
Meaning
This quote means you should not wait for perfect conditions before beginning. Progress starts when you use what you already have, and better opportunities and resources often appear only after you take the first step.
